none
Ao realizar logoff no Windows Seven, alguns processos são encerrados. RRS feed

  • Pergunta

  • Tenho um processo que deve ser mantido ativo (rodando) mesmo que o usuário realize um logoff. Existe alguma forma de manter estes processos (geralmente iniciados por usuários, não com a conta system) ativos no momento que é realizado um logoff da estação? O processo em questao é um vnc e quando o usuario faz logoff, a conexão é encerrada.

    O mais curioso é que com um cliente pago, não ocorre este incidente. Ex: Logmein.

    terça-feira, 11 de janeiro de 2011 12:41

Respostas

Todas as Respostas

  • Gabriel,

    no XP eu adicionava uma chave em:

    H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run

    Veja os existentes e faça igual.


    Gilberto Soares Lopes http://videoedicas.blogspot.com/
    terça-feira, 11 de janeiro de 2011 12:54
    Moderador
  • Gabriel,

    no XP eu adicionava uma chave em:

    H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Run

    Veja os existentes e faça igual.


    Gilberto Soares Lopes http://videoedicas.blogspot.com/

     

    Gilberto,

    Obrigado pela rápida resposta. Me corrija se eu estiver enganado, mas esta chave faria com que o processo seja executado no momento que o usuário realizar o logon.

    Houve a mudança no tratamento dos serviços no windows 2008 e por consequência no seven também, que serviços que interajam com a área de trabalho, no momento de logoff são derrubados. Mas curiosamente o Logmein consegue burlar esta "funcionalidade".

     

    terça-feira, 11 de janeiro de 2011 13:24
  • Gabriel,

    veja essa solução então:

    http://social.technet.microsoft.com/Forums/pt-BR/winxppt/thread/2fb9d842-5b8c-42d5-b800-c749e99dee9f

     


    Gilberto Soares Lopes http://videoedicas.blogspot.com/
    terça-feira, 11 de janeiro de 2011 13:39
    Moderador
  • Gabriel,

    veja essa solução então:

    http://social.technet.microsoft.com/Forums/pt-BR/winxppt/thread/2fb9d842-5b8c-42d5-b800-c749e99dee9f

     


    Gilberto Soares Lopes http://videoedicas.blogspot.com/


    Gilberto,

    Tentei esta solução, mas nada faz com que o serviço fique rodando no momento do logoff. Acredito que possa ter uma GPO para isso, mas até agora não encontrei.

    terça-feira, 11 de janeiro de 2011 14:00
  • Gabriel, não é a solução exata, mais sim uma altrnativa, os usuarios poderiam ao invés de dar logoff, simplesmente dar um WINDOWS + L para bloquear a estação, sem finalizar os procesos.

    No caso de serviços, e não de processos, vc deveria edita a chave H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\NOME DO SERVIÇO

    Qual processo ou serviço especifico vc quer manter ao fazr logoff?


    Diego Piffaretti- www.mundotecnologico.net
    terça-feira, 11 de janeiro de 2011 16:14
  • Gabriel, não é a solução exata, mais sim uma altrnativa, os usuarios poderiam ao invés de dar logoff, simplesmente dar um WINDOWS + L para bloquear a estação, sem finalizar os procesos.

    No caso de serviços, e não de processos, vc deveria edita a chave H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\NOME DO SERVIÇO

    Qual processo ou serviço especifico vc quer manter ao fazr logoff?


    Diego Piffaretti- www.mundotecnologico.net


    Diego,

    O problema todo é que ao realizar um logoff, não somente o vnc, mas diversos outros processos (leia-se serviços, processos, aplicativos) levantados tanto pelo usuário logado, quanto pelo SYSTEM e que interajam com a area de trabalho são encerrados.

    Usei o exemplo do logmein, uma solução de controle remoto que não é interrompido pelo logoff do usuário. Voce faz o acesso e quando realiza um logoff a conexão nao é interrompida. Analisando melhor pude notar que existem 3 processos rodando para o logmein, logo um deles deve manter a conexão ativa e logo apos levanta o processo do logmein novamente. Mas para isso o tempo de timeout de conexão deve ser alto, ou sei lá o que o logmein faz para nao perder esta conexão.

     

    terça-feira, 11 de janeiro de 2011 18:00
  • Olá gabriel.

    Veja o seguinte link, se ele te ajuda:
    http://forum.ultravnc.info/viewtopic.php?p=72039

     

    Abraço.

     


    Richard Juhasz
    • Marcado como Resposta Richard Juhasz segunda-feira, 17 de janeiro de 2011 16:40
    sexta-feira, 14 de janeiro de 2011 19:36